General Statement
The Institute of National Security Research and Education (INSRE), MilTech, the Applied Research Lab (ARL), and Ardent Forge strengthen national security by delivering technologies, supporting researchers, and preparing leaders who will contribute to safeguarding the future of Montana and the nation. Specifically, MilTech's mission is to accelerate the transition of new technology to the U.S. government. Further information can be found at INSRE and MilTech.
